Handover: template rendering performance (Olen → future maintainers)

The Copperlane render service was slow because partials were recompiled on every request. I added an LRU compile cache and precompilation of the top twenty templates at boot; p95 dropped from 380ms to 60ms. Cache invalidation is tied to template file mtime, so deploys must preserve timestamps. The service boots with the configuration values below.

service settings:
[silwyn]
host = silwyn.crelvogrid.internal
user = silwyn_svc
database = silwyn_prod

Action item: The `tailwisp` CLI silently dropped log lines when the Brindlecore aggregator rotated shards mid-session. Support spent 40 minutes chasing phantom gaps. Fix is shipped in v2.9, but older installs linger on support laptops. Everyone must upgrade by Friday and confirm version with `tailwisp --version`. Do not trust tail output from pre-2.9 builds during incidents; pull raw shards instead. Upgrade steps and the shard-pull fallback procedure are documented on the page below.

wiki page, tahaf-tajog: https://jira.ordindyn.corp/pipeline

Ticket #—  SquatSentry 2.3 failed its signature check on the publish step. Looks like the scanner artifact was built on the old runner, which still had last quarter's rotated credentials. Rebuild on runner-blue, re-run the typo-squat corpus tests, and re-sign. For the re-sign, use the key below.

release key, hadug-kawef: bky13_mPGeFZeR1GZ1G

## Changelog — StridePulse Reader v4.8.1

Key rotation. The signing key used to validate plugin packages for the StridePulse timing-chip reader has been rotated following our scheduled quarterly policy; no compromise is suspected. Plugins signed with the previous key will continue to verify until the end of next month, after which the old key is revoked. Please re-sign and republish your plugins before that date. The new signing key follows.

signing key of bagap-yawep = bky13_TbfT6ZMUoGJo2